    We need to talk about that four letter word DIET! We’ve all ridden the diet rollercoaster, experiencing the highs of losses and the downs of gains. In desperation we’ve forked out countless dollars on diet plans, the latest weight loss fad, shakes, detox programs, self help and recipe books etc etc. Non of these diets have worked in the long term, otherwise most of us would not be here seeking support from our global family.

    We’ve all fallen off the wagon. Maybe due to the stress of focusing on points or calories or due to an overwhelming sense of deprivation or the difficulties of fitting the ‘diet’ into our social life or the stresses of day to day life and needing to put others before ourselves. Crash diets always have a rebound, just think of the Biggest Losers. So please, please, please stop turning 5:2, Intermittent Fasting, ADF … into another ‘diet.’

    This is a very flexible WOL with countless variations backed by significant scientific research. The secret to sustainability is to find what works for each of us and to fit it in to our lifestyle. It doesn’t matter if we have a bad day or week. It’s ok to take a break. Whether you count calories, watch portions, eat to TDEE, weigh or not, use a diary, exercise, take supplements, etc etc are all personal choices. If you need a plan to follow there are countless menu plans on the internet. This WOL shouldn’t be something forced upon us but something we choose to do to make a difference.

    It’s time to start considering this as an opportunity to boost our health so we can live life to the fullest. Weight loss is the bonus.
